What are some effects of the tiny beads called microplastics that are a large component of ocean garbage patches?

Microplastics are very small pieces of plastic (less than 5 mm in diameter) which can be found in the environment. Microplastics mostly come from larger pieces of plastic which degrade and turn into these tiny parts of plastic. 
It has been shown that microplastics are a very important problem of the marine environment, mainly because they are ingested by marine organisms. Due to their small size, they can be embedded in the tissues of many organisms. This can cause serious health problems, from physical harm to starvation caused by a false feeling of satiety.

In humans, the allele for having dimples is dominant to the allele for not having dimples. What would you expect to see in the o
zmey [24]
The answer is <span>All of their offspring will have dimples.
</span>
A - dominant allele for having dimples
a - recessive allele for not having dimples

AA - individuals with dimples     (mother in our case)
Aa - individuals with dimples      (father in our case)
aa - individuals without dimples    

The cross would look like this:
Parents:      AA      x      Aa
Children: AA    AA    Aa    Aa

So, all of the offspring will have dimples
